The verdict

Belmont Village Public Water sits in the upper third of the sitemap cohort by violation count (245), so the tables below sample a dense compliance trail rather than a near-clean ledger. Population served is mid-pack at 2,400 (mid served population (≤ 3,309)). Health-based share is 2% (middle-third health share (≤ 23%)). No UCMR5 PFAS test appears for this system in this extract.

Violation Count vs. the National Corpus

Belmont Village Public Water has 245 recorded EPA violations, 88% of the 29,740 public water systems serving 500+ people nationwide carry fewer, and 12% carry more. 2% of this system's own violations are health-based (4 of 245), and it ranks #12,257 of 29,740 by population served among that same cohort.
